-- OBJECTIVE:
|
| 27 |
|
|
-- Check that an explicit declaration in the private part of an instance
|
| 28 |
|
|
-- does not override an implicit declaration in the instance, unless the
|
| 29 |
|
|
-- corresponding explicit declaration in the generic overrides a
|
| 30 |
|
|
-- corresponding implicit declaration in the generic. Check for primitive
|
| 31 |
|
|
-- subprograms of tagged types.
|
| 32 |
|
|
--
|
| 33 |
|
|
-- TEST DESCRIPTION:
|
| 34 |
|
|
-- Consider the following:
|
| 35 |
|
|
--
|
| 36 |
|
|
-- type Ancestor is tagged null record;
|
| 37 |
|
|
-- procedure R (X: in Ancestor);
|
| 38 |
|
|
--
|
| 39 |
|
|
-- generic
|
| 40 |
|
|
-- type Formal is new Ancestor with private;
|
| 41 |
|
|
-- package G is
|
| 42 |
|
|
-- type T is new Formal with null record;
|
| 43 |
|
|
-- -- Implicit procedure R (X: in T);
|
| 44 |
|
|
-- procedure P (X: in T); -- (1)
|
| 45 |
|
|
-- private
|
| 46 |
|
|
-- procedure Q (X: in T); -- (2)
|
| 47 |
|
|
-- procedure R (X: in T); -- (3) Overrides implicit R in generic.
|
| 48 |
|
|
-- end G;
|
| 49 |
|
|
--
|
| 50 |
|
|
-- type Actual is new Ancestor with null record;
|
| 51 |
|
|
-- procedure P (X: in Actual);
|
| 52 |
|
|
-- procedure Q (X: in Actual);
|
| 53 |
|
|
-- procedure R (X: in Actual);
|
| 54 |
|
|
--
|
| 55 |
|
|
-- package Instance is new G (Formal => Actual);
|
| 56 |
|
|
--
|
| 57 |
|
|
-- In the instance, the copy of P at (1) overrides Actual's P, since it
|
| 58 |
|
|
-- is declared in the visible part of the instance. The copy of Q at (2)
|
| 59 |
|
|
-- does not override anything. The copy of R at (3) overrides Actual's
|
| 60 |
|
|
-- R, even though it is declared in the private part, because within
|
| 61 |
|
|
-- the generic the explicit declaration of R overrides an implicit
|
| 62 |
|
|
-- declaration.
|
| 63 |
|
|
--
|
| 64 |
|
|
-- Thus, for calls involving a parameter with tag T:
|
| 65 |
|
|
-- - Calls to P will execute the body declared for T.
|
| 66 |
|
|
-- - Calls to Q from within Instance will execute the body declared
|
| 67 |
|
|
-- for T.
|
| 68 |
|
|
-- - Calls to Q from outside Instance will execute the body declared
|
| 69 |
|
|
-- for Actual.
|
| 70 |
|
|
-- - Calls to R will execute the body declared for T.
|
| 71 |
|
|
--
|
| 72 |
|
|
-- Verify this behavior for both dispatching and nondispatching calls to
|
| 73 |
|
|
-- Q and R.
